Bagdogra, in North Bengal, lies at the foothills of eastern Himalayas, and is the gateway town to Darjeeling and Kalimpong. While here you can visit the Kali Mandir, Mahananda Wildlife Sanctuary, ISKCON temple and the Mahananda - Teesta sanctuary. The key animals found here are the Indian bison, barking deer and Indian elephants. Opportunities for river rafting, camping and mountaineering are also easily available. The best time to visit Bagdogra is between October and March to enjoy the cold weather, as this city is at the foothills of snow-capped mountains.
The Bagdogra Airport connects the city to all major metro cities in India and some prominent international hubs as well. Here is a look at the major airlines which fly to Bagdogra.
How to reach Bagdogra from major Indian cities
The top domestic airlines with regular flights to Bagdogra are Air India, Jet Airways, Indigo Airlines, SpiceJet and Go Air.
Bangalore to Bagdogra: If you are flying from Bangalore, there are 5 one-stop flights and the shortest flight time is 4 hours on Indigo. Jet Airways, SpiceJet and GoAir provides one-stop flights with travel time of around 5.5 hours.
Chennai to Bagdogra: From Chennai, you can choose from 4 single-stop Indigo flights. The single, daily Air India flight reaches in 27 hours. There are 6 single-stop options on Jet Airways. The single one-stop SpiceJet and GoAir flights reach in around 4 hours.
Delhi to Bagdogra: From Delhi, a direct daily flight from Indigo Airlines and Air India each, reach in 2 hours. You have 5 options on Jet Airways, 1 on SpiceJet and 2 on
GoAir.
Mumbai to Bagdogra: The shortest travel time of 4 hours 25 minutes is on Indigo Airlines with 6 single-stop flights. The 2 Air India hopping flights take between 6 and 18 hours. More than 10 one-stop Jet Airways flights, fly to Bagdogra daily. From Mumbai, you have 2 options on SpiceJet and 4 options on GoAir.
The stopovers for most of the flights are at Delhi and/or Kolkata.
